
It seems like the entire world is amped up for the “Star Wars – The Force Awakens” trailer except for one man, series creator George Lucas.
Lucas told NY Post’s Page Six that he hasn’t seen the trailer yet and doesn’t plan to.
“I don’t know anything about it. I haven’t seen it yet,” he said. “Because it’s not in the movie theater. I like going to the movies and watching the whole thing there.”
While the trailer itself was, in fact, released in 30 theaters in North America, the film is about a year away from release.
In October, 2013, Lucas’ son Jett told YouTube channel Flicks and the City that his dad was interested in what was happening with the new installment of the series directed by J.J. Abrams.
“As any parent watching their kid going to college would. He’s constantly talking to J.J. Obviously, J.J. was handpicked,” he said.
“He is there to guide, whenever, he’ll help where he can. At the same time, he wants to let it go and become its new generation.”
Jett also added that his dad was torn on the idea of selling the rights to the franchise.
And dad will be there to see his “child” off into the world when the new film hits theaters in December 2015, telling the Post, “I plan to see it when it’s released.”
